Principal Accountabilities

  • Perform regular inspections, maintenance passes, and servicing of utility systems such as HVAC, cooling towers, compressors, and generators to ensure optimal performance longevity and zero downtime of all utility equipment.
  • Respond promptly to utility system breakdowns and perform necessary repairs to minimize production downtime and maintain continuous plant operation.
  • Carryout regular safety inspections to ensure that all utility systems comply with relevant safety regulations and standards.
  • Collaborate with all teams to provide support and meet their utility needs so as to ensure seamless factory operation.
  • Supervise the activities of Original Equipment Manufacturers (OEMs) and external contractors on company grounds to ensure compliance with standards, timely completion of projects, and quality of work.
  • Maintain accurate records of equipment status, maintenance activities, repairs, system performance, and incidents for proper monitoring and to keep management informed

Context of Job

  • Framework & Boundaries: The Utility Technician operates within a framework of established SOPs, safety protocols, and regulatory compliance, maintaining accurate records and collaborating with production teams, OEMs, and contractors. Boundaries include obtaining approvals for major decisions from the Utility Division in charge, managing resources within budget constraints, ensuring safety and compliance, and focusing on maintaining utility systems such as HVAC, cooling towers, compressors, and generators.
